大别山北部变质镁铁一超镁铁质岩带中斜长角门岩类的常量、微量和稀土元素地球化学特征均表明,它们可划分为二类:Ⅰ类为洋岛型拉班玄武岩;Ⅱ类为岛弧型玄武岩且其中大多数属钙碱性玄武质安山岩和少数属拉班玄武岩。其中,前者Ti、Nb、Cr等元素富集,且Nb/Th=11、Zr/Nb=9.6和Hf/Ta=2.9~11;后者以Ti、Nb、P、Hf等元素亏损和Sr、K、Rb、Ba、Th等元素富集为特征,且Nb/Th=2.3和Zr/Nb=23.1。它们可能分别属于洋岛型和岛弧型蛇绿岩中成员。 The constants, trace elements and geochemical characteristics of REE in the metamorphic mafic-ultramafic rocks in the northern part of the Dabie Mountains indicate that they can be divided into two types: Ⅰ is the Yangba-type Laban basalt; and Ⅱ It is island arc basalts and most of them are calc-basaltic andesite and a few belong to Laban basalts. Among them, the former elements such as Ti, Nb and Cr are enriched, and Nb / Th = 11, Zr / Nb = 9.6 and Hf / Ta = 2.9 to 11; Depletion and enrichment of Sr, K, Rb, Ba, Th and other elements, and Nb / Th = 2.3 and Zr / Nb = 23.1. They may belong to members of the oceanic and island arc type ophiolite respectively.
